D:\a\CLEO5\CLEO5\.output\Release\CLEO.pdb
Static task
static1
Behavioral task
behavioral1
Sample
0993a0079667a072f30e3791a499d577e1563cbe4f741d3805d53f041c47088f.dll
Resource
win7-20240221-en
Behavioral task
behavioral2
Sample
0993a0079667a072f30e3791a499d577e1563cbe4f741d3805d53f041c47088f.dll
Resource
win10v2004-20240426-en
General
-
Target
0993a0079667a072f30e3791a499d577e1563cbe4f741d3805d53f041c47088f
-
Size
449KB
-
MD5
0eda6af5009bfc48cd8b57613856d788
-
SHA1
17d118a9d384ca1bf9854081135b369a6a969f7c
-
SHA256
0993a0079667a072f30e3791a499d577e1563cbe4f741d3805d53f041c47088f
-
SHA512
e1c3a7c93527095f00b6fb5457c6bc0be78bb5105fd4ffcaedee9c21e7ca072988757e7c731a9936f7ebe7dffe464767a12c50131a794403f4e510e2adf72879
-
SSDEEP
12288:G6wxmS3xnmq6lOUXTtdy0jJ1z+8iXfQZ/:G6A/Efp+CZ
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
Processes:
resource 0993a0079667a072f30e3791a499d577e1563cbe4f741d3805d53f041c47088f
Files
-
0993a0079667a072f30e3791a499d577e1563cbe4f741d3805d53f041c47088f.dll windows:6 windows x86 arch:x86
39c1be27879ed85f558386d8ce5b57e2
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
PDB Paths
Imports
kernel32
GetModuleFileNameA
VirtualProtect
GetModuleHandleA
FindFirstFileA
Module32Next
FindNextFileA
Module32First
CreateToolhelp32Snapshot
CloseHandle
GetCurrentProcessId
GetLocalTime
LoadLibraryA
FreeLibrary
WritePrivateProfileStringA
CreateDirectoryA
GetPrivateProfileIntA
WriteConsoleW
HeapSize
SetStdHandle
GetProcessHeap
FreeEnvironmentStringsW
GetEnvironmentStringsW
GetCommandLineW
GetCommandLineA
LocalFree
FormatMessageA
CreateDirectoryW
CreateFileW
FindClose
FindFirstFileExW
FindNextFileW
GetFileAttributesExW
GetFinalPathNameByHandleW
GetFullPathNameW
SetEndOfFile
SetFilePointerEx
AreFileApisANSI
GetLastError
GetFileInformationByHandleEx
MultiByteToWideChar
WideCharToMultiByte
InitializeSRWLock
ReleaseSRWLockExclusive
AcquireSRWLockExclusive
EnterCriticalSection
LeaveCriticalSection
InitializeCriticalSectionEx
TryEnterCriticalSection
DeleteCriticalSection
GetCurrentThreadId
QueryPerformanceCounter
QueryPerformanceFrequency
WaitForSingleObjectEx
Sleep
GetExitCodeThread
EncodePointer
DecodePointer
GetSystemTimeAsFileTime
GetModuleHandleW
GetProcAddress
LCMapStringEx
GetStringTypeW
GetCPInfo
UnhandledExceptionFilter
SetUnhandledExceptionFilter
GetCurrentProcess
TerminateProcess
IsProcessorFeaturePresent
IsDebuggerPresent
GetStartupInfoW
InitializeSListHead
RtlUnwind
RaiseException
InterlockedFlushSList
SetLastError
InitializeCriticalSectionAndSpinCount
TlsAlloc
TlsGetValue
TlsSetValue
TlsFree
LoadLibraryExW
ExitProcess
GetModuleHandleExW
CreateThread
ExitThread
FreeLibraryAndExitThread
GetModuleFileNameW
HeapFree
HeapAlloc
GetStdHandle
GetFileType
GetFileSizeEx
FlushFileBuffers
WriteFile
GetConsoleCP
GetConsoleMode
LCMapStringW
GetLocaleInfoW
IsValidLocale
GetUserDefaultLCID
EnumSystemLocalesW
ReadFile
ReadConsoleW
HeapReAlloc
IsValidCodePage
GetACP
GetOEMCP
user32
SetWindowLongA
ShowWindow
MessageBoxA
PostMessageA
GetWindowLongA
shell32
SHQueryUserNotificationState
Exports
Exports
_CLEO_AddScriptDeleteDelegate@4
_CLEO_CreateCustomScript@12
_CLEO_GetFloatOpcodeParam@4
_CLEO_GetGameVersion@0
_CLEO_GetIntOpcodeParam@4
_CLEO_GetInternalAudioStream@8
_CLEO_GetLastCreatedCustomScript@0
_CLEO_GetOpcodeParamsArray@0
_CLEO_GetOperandType@4
_CLEO_GetParamsHandledCount@0
_CLEO_GetPointerToScriptVariable@4
_CLEO_GetScriptByFilename@8
_CLEO_GetScriptByName@16
_CLEO_GetScriptDebugMode@4
_CLEO_GetScriptFilename@4
_CLEO_GetScriptInfoStr@16
_CLEO_GetScriptParamInfoStr@12
_CLEO_GetScriptTextureById@8
_CLEO_GetScriptVersion@4
_CLEO_GetScriptWorkDir@4
_CLEO_GetVarArgCount@4
_CLEO_GetVersion@0
_CLEO_ListDirectory@16
_CLEO_ListDirectoryFree@8
_CLEO_Log@8
_CLEO_PeekFloatOpcodeParam@4
_CLEO_PeekIntOpcodeParam@4
_CLEO_PeekPointerToScriptVariable@4
_CLEO_ReadParamsFormatted@16
_CLEO_ReadStringOpcodeParam@12
_CLEO_ReadStringParamWriteBuffer@16
_CLEO_ReadStringPointerOpcodeParam@12
_CLEO_RecordOpcodeParams@8
_CLEO_RegisterCallback@8
_CLEO_RegisterCommand@8
_CLEO_RegisterOpcode@8
_CLEO_RemoveScriptDeleteDelegate@4
_CLEO_ResolvePath@12
_CLEO_RetrieveOpcodeParams@8
_CLEO_SetFloatOpcodeParam@8
_CLEO_SetIntOpcodeParam@8
_CLEO_SetScriptDebugMode@8
_CLEO_SetScriptWorkDir@8
_CLEO_SetThreadCondResult@8
_CLEO_SkipOpcodeParams@8
_CLEO_SkipUnusedVarArgs@4
_CLEO_ThreadJumpAtLabelPtr@8
_CLEO_WriteStringOpcodeParam@8
missionLocals
opcodeParams
staticThreads
Sections
.text Size: 336KB - Virtual size: 335K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 81KB - Virtual size: 81K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 6KB - Virtual size: 176K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 7KB - Virtual size: 6K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 17KB - Virtual size: 17K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